    Understanding Nonprofit Volunteer Management

    Volunteers are the backbone of most nonprofit organizations, contributing billions of hours annually to causes they care about. However, successful volunteer management requires more than just good intentions. It demands a systematic approach that attracts the right people, provides them with meaningful experiences, and retains them for long-term impact. A well-structured volunteer roadmap ensures that your organization maximizes both volunteer satisfaction and organizational effectiveness.

    What is a Nonprofit Volunteer Roadmap?

    A nonprofit volunteer roadmap is a strategic plan that outlines the complete volunteer lifecycle within your organization. From initial outreach and recruitment to ongoing engagement and recognition, this roadmap serves as a comprehensive guide for managing volunteer relationships. It helps nonprofits create consistent experiences, streamline processes, and build a sustainable volunteer program that supports organizational goals while providing fulfilling opportunities for community members who want to make a difference.

    Essential Components of Your Volunteer Roadmap

    Building an effective volunteer roadmap requires careful consideration of several critical elements:

    • Needs Assessment. Start by clearly identifying what volunteer roles your organization needs. Define specific tasks, required skills, time commitments, and how each role contributes to your mission. This foundation ensures you attract volunteers whose abilities match your actual needs.
    • Recruitment Strategy. Develop targeted outreach campaigns across multiple channels including social media, community partnerships, volunteer matching websites, and local events. Create compelling volunteer descriptions that highlight both the impact and personal benefits of volunteering with your organization.
    • Application and Screening Process. Establish clear procedures for volunteer applications, background checks when necessary, and interview processes. This step ensures volunteers are well-suited for their roles and helps create safe environments for both volunteers and those you serve.
    • Orientation and Training. Design comprehensive onboarding programs that introduce volunteers to your mission, values, policies, and specific role responsibilities. Quality training increases volunteer confidence and effectiveness while reducing turnover rates.
    • Ongoing Support and Recognition. Create systems for regular check-ins, feedback collection, skill development opportunities, and volunteer appreciation. Consistent support and recognition are key factors in long-term volunteer retention and satisfaction.

    Managing these interconnected components requires careful coordination and timing. Each phase depends on successful completion of previous steps, and overlapping recruitment cycles mean you'll often be managing volunteers at different stages simultaneously.
